Monte Vista CAN be gifted in the same country...Here's How!

I know a lot of you have been trying to find a way to do this for your contests, and after McCrudd asked over on the Store forum, I got to thinking about how our dearly loved sneaky bunny, envira-X (with helper bunnies) gifted me SEA...thru Amazon. I thought I'd share it here, in case anyone was interested in grabbing it for a contest prize.

Monte Vista isn't available as a digital download; it will have to be physically sent to the winner's home. The good news is, this can be done without any personal info changing hands. Here's how...


If you go to the page on Amazon for it:
http://www.amazon.com/The-Sims-3-Monte-Vista-PCMac/dp/B00A39IEMO/ref=sr_1_1?ie=UTF8&qid=1357865577&sr=8-1&keywords=sims+3+monte+vista


You'll see this:
Amazon.jpg


If you scroll ALL the way to the bottom of the page, you'll see THIS:
MonteVista.jpg


You're basically emailing an Amazon gift card for the exact amount of the game. The shipping on Monte Vista is currently free from Amazon. It appears they're not doing DD (Digital Download) on the world itself, but this will get it mailed to the person's home without personal info being traded.

Hope that helps!

Edit: Sorry - I realized later that the recipient has to be from the same country as the sender. That definitely puts a dent in the prize pools. I'm sorry I didn't think to check that first!

    Good question! If you can send an Amazon gift card to different countries, then yes, but I've never tried to do that. I'll go ask on their Help board and see what they say.

    *Does Terminator voice..."I'll be back."

    Edit: BAH! They do appear to be country-specific. If it's bought from Amazon.com, it's it's only redeemable in the US, if it's bought from Amazon.UK, they can only be redeemed in GB. Etc, Etc.

    http://www.amazon.com/gp/gc/ref=g_gc-gc_dp_redirect

    Quote:
    2. Limitations.
    Amazon.com Gift Cards may not be redeemed for the purchase of products at Amazon.co.uk, Amazon.de, Amazon.fr, Amazon.co.jp, Amazon.ca, Amazon.es, Amazon.it, or any other website operated by Amazon.com, its affiliates, or any other person or entity, except as indicated by these terms and conditions. Amazon.com Gift Cards cannot be used to purchase other gift cards. Amazon.com Gift Cards cannot be reloaded, resold, transferred for value, redeemed for cash or applied to any other account, except to the extent required by law. Unused Amazon.com Gift Card balances in an Amazon account may not be transferred.



    Sorry, Guys! It didn't even cross my mind to check that first. :(

    8) Hon there is a way around the country specific thing and I know this from experience. My Mom purchased an amazon giftcard to me last year from amazon UK, for a book I needed for Norsk class, and she lives in the US. So anyone can go direct to any amazon around the world and purchase giftcards for anyone in those countries ;) Amazon EU has 5 separate sites....
    Amazon.UK
    Amazon Deutschland
    Amazon France
    Amazon Italia
    Amazon Spain

    I'm sure there are many other Amazon sites around the globe, but these are all the european sites, hope this information helps everyone ;)
